SOCI 3340 - Sociology of Sport and Leisure

Institution:
Texas State University
Subject:
Description:
The theories and research in leisure and popular culture will serve as the broad framework. An emphasis will be placed on the sub-area of sport sociology, including such topics as sport and aggression, competition, children, women, minorities, professionalism, and others.
